Leading the Charge in Renewable Energy: Scholarships for Women in Renewable Energy in North Dakota

North Dakota has emerged as a leader in renewable energy, particularly in wind and solar power generation. Despite the growth in this sector, women continue to be significantly underrepresented in technical fields, indicating a need for scholarships that inspire the next generation of female leaders. The Scholarships for Women in Renewable Energy in North Dakota aim to address this gap by supporting female high school seniors interested in pursuing studies in renewable energy.

To qualify for these scholarships, applicants must be female high school seniors in North Dakota with demonstrated financial need and a strong interest in renewable energy. The program encourages applicants to showcase their involvement in related extracurricular activities, such as science fairs or environmental clubs, allowing candidates to illustrate their commitment to the field.

The application process involves submitting a detailed personal statement, letters of recommendation, and proof of participation in relevant projects or initiatives.
